You can buy one here for 12,900; official/localized LG version with local warranty.

The GNEX 4 supports all GSM and 3G bands here so no issues working with any/all mobile service providers. 850/2100 MHz are the required 3G frequencies now.

My GNex 4 (purchased form the Play Store in the U.S.) has the Thai language option in Settings, Language & input, Language. Thai characters are displayed and you can use the DroidSans Thai Keyboard, or one of several others, all available for download from the Play Store.

Larger screen Android phones from Samsung are probably cool these days? The GNex 4, and newer 5, run stock Android, and LG doesn't really promote them here so awareness is probably close to zero.
